Rastafari, from Coral Gardens to an Apology

Rastafari began in Jamaica in the early 1930s, among people formed by Marcus Garvey's movement, who read the coronation of Ras Tafari Makonnen as Haile Selassie I of Ethiopia in 1930 as the fulfilment of prophecy. Leonard Howell was among the first preachers and established the Pinnacle community in the hills, which the colonial authorities raided repeatedly and finally destroyed.

The movement developed houses rather than a church. The Nyabinghi order is the oldest, centred on the grounation drumming assemblies. Bobo Ashanti, founded by Prince Emmanuel Charles Edwards, is a disciplined communal order with its own dress and observances. The Twelve Tribes of Israel, founded in the 1960s, is the most internationally dispersed and is the house Bob Marley belonged to. Common to most is the Ital diet, the wearing of locks, the reasoning session as the form of theological discussion, and a language shaped by deliberate substitution, most famously the use of I and I in place of the first person.

Persecution was severe and official. The worst episode was at Coral Gardens near Montego Bay in April 1963, when an incident at a petrol station led to a police and military operation in which Rastafari were killed, and many more were rounded up, beaten and had their locks forcibly cut. The Jamaican government issued a formal apology for Coral Gardens in 2017 and established a trust fund for survivors.

Haile Selassie visited Jamaica in 1966 to enormous crowds, an event Rastafari still date from. He did not accept the divine identification made of him, and the movement's response to his death in 1975 varies by house, which is one of the genuine internal differences within it.
